Quantifying the mechanics of locomotion of the schistosome pathogen with respect to changes in its physical environment
2019-04-05
Abstract excerpt
Schistosomiasis is a chronic and morbid disease of poverty affecting approximately 200 million people worldwide. Mature schistosome flatworms wander in the host’s hepatic portal and mesenteric venous system where they encounter a range of blood flow conditions and geometrical confinement.
